【经验分享】从实践中学习ollama模型卸载的最佳技巧
发布时间: 2025-06-04 13:57:15 阅读量: 43 订阅数: 17 


Ollama模型拉取故障排查与解决方案

# 1. ollama模型概述
在当今IT领域,ollama模型作为一个引人注目的技术术语,正在引起广泛关注。本章旨在为读者提供ollama模型的概括介绍,为进一步深入探讨其工作原理和在实践中的应用打下基础。ollama模型作为一项复杂的算法技术,旨在通过先进的数据处理能力和机器学习的智能决策,解决数据密集型任务中的关键挑战。
## 1.1 ollama模型定义
ollama模型是一种高级算法框架,专门设计用于处理大规模数据集,并从中提取有用信息。它集成了数据挖掘、机器学习和深度学习等技术,以优化决策过程并提升预测精度。由于其强大的分析能力,ollama模型在多个行业得以应用,如金融服务、医疗健康和市场分析等。
## 1.2 模型的重要性
了解ollama模型的重要性,首先要认识到当前技术环境对处理速度和数据处理能力的需求日益增长。ollama模型通过其高效的算法和灵活的架构设计,不仅提升了处理速度,也扩展了处理复杂数据集的能力。对于企业而言,这不仅意味着决策的优化,也是成本效益的提高和市场竞争力的增强。
在接下来的章节中,我们将深入探讨ollama模型的工作原理、优势、局限性以及在实际中的应用。通过分析模型架构与实践应用,我们将更好地理解这一技术如何在实际场景中发挥作用。
# 2. 理论基础与ollama模型的重要性
## 2.1 ollama模型的工作原理
### 2.1.1 模型架构解析
ollama模型是一种复杂的机器学习框架,它由多个层次组成,每个层次都承担着不同的任务。在模型的核心,我们通常可以识别到以下关键组件:
1. **输入层**:该层负责接收原始数据。在不同的应用中,输入可以是图像像素、文本字符序列、声音波形等。
2. **嵌入层**:在处理非数值数据时,嵌入层将输入数据转换为连续的向量空间中的点,这些点在向量空间中的位置能够表征原始数据的语义信息。
3. **隐藏层**:包括多个卷积层、池化层、循环层等,其目的是从数据中提取特征,这些特征能够表达数据的不同维度特征。
4. **输出层**:基于前面层提取的特征,输出层提供最终的预测结果。输出层的类型和结构取决于模型的应用类型,如分类任务中可能使用Softmax函数。
ollama模型能够通过调整内部连接权重来学习和适应数据的模式。训练过程中,模型的输出与期望输出之间的误差会通过反向传播算法来指导权重的更新,以最小化预测误差。
### 2.1.2 模型在实践中的应用
ollama模型在多个行业已经得到了广泛的应用,特别是在处理大量数据的场景,如图像和语音识别、自然语言处理以及推荐系统中。在这些应用中,模型能够展现出令人印象深刻的能力,例如:
- 在图像识别中,ollama模型可以准确识别图像中的对象和场景。
- 在语音识别中,ollama模型能够转换和理解不同口音和语速的语音。
- 在自然语言处理中,ollama模型用于文本分类、情感分析和机器翻译等任务。
- 在推荐系统中,ollama模型能够分析用户行为并预测用户可能感兴趣的商品或服务。
为了实现这些应用,数据科学家和工程师需要通过大量的数据准备和模型调整,以确保模型能够准确地执行特定任务。在某些情况下,模型需要经过数百万次的迭代和微调,才能够达到实用的准确率。
## 2.2 ollama模型的优势与局限性
### 2.2.1 模型的优势分析
ollama模型之所以在众多机器学习模型中脱颖而出,主要得益于其以下优势:
- **强大的特征提取能力**:由于模型中包含多层的非线性变换,ollama模型能够捕获数据中复杂的模式和关系。
- **泛化能力**:经过适当训练的ollama模型能够在未见过的数据上做出准确预测,具有很好的泛化性能。
- **可扩展性**:ollama模型可以适应不同规模的数据集,从小型数据到大规模数据都可以取得较好的效果。
- **灵活性和多样性**:通过改变模型结构和参数,ollama可以被应用于各种不同的任务。
### 2.2.2 模型的局限性探讨
尽管ollama模型有很多优点,但也有其局限性:
- **计算资源消耗大**:ollama模型通常需要大量的计算资源进行训练和推理,这可能导致高昂的成本。
- **数据依赖性**:ollama模型在训练时需要大量的标记数据,这在某些领域可能难以获取。
- **可解释性差**:由于模型的复杂性,ollama模型很难提供可解释的决策过程,这在一些需要透明度的应用场景中可能不被接受。
由于这些局限性,研究人员和开发者在设计和部署ollama模型时需要进行权衡。他们必须在追求模型性能和满足实际应用约束之间找到平衡点。随着技术的发展,许多研究正在试图解决这些局限性,包括开发更高效的训练算法和减少对数据量的依赖。
# 3. ollama模型卸载的理论与实践技巧
## 3.1 卸载前的理论准备
### 3.1.1 理解卸载流程的重要性
在进行任何软件的卸载之前,理解整个卸载流程是至关重要的。对于ollama模型而言,其复杂的系统架构和依赖关系意味着需要谨慎处理每一个卸载步骤。正确的卸载流程不仅可以避免对系统造成不必要的损害,还可以确保数据的完整性和系统的稳定性。理解卸载流程的重要性包括以下几个方面:
- **确保数据备份:** 在开始卸载之前,务必要对模型的所有相关数据进行备份。考虑到ollama模型可能存储了大量用户数据和训练结果,这一点尤为重要。
- **最小化风险:** 按照正确的流程卸载可以最小化系统故障的风险,确保业务连续性。
- **释放资源:** 卸载不再使用的模型可以帮助释放计算资源,提高系统性能。
- **遵从法规:** 在某些行业,正确的卸载流程是符合法律法规要求的一部分。
理解这些理论基础,可以帮助我们制定出一套更加安全、高效的卸载策略。
### 3.1.2 常见卸载工具和技术比较
为了执行ollama模型的卸载,存在多种工具和技术可供选择。以下是一些常见的卸载方法的比较:
- **命令行工具:** 一些系统和框架提供了专门的命令行工具来卸载软件。例如,在Linux系统中,`apt-get`或`yum`可以用来卸载软件包。
```bash
sudo apt-get remove ollama-model
```
在上述命令中,`remove`参数用于卸载指定的软件包,这里指的是“ollama-model”。需要注意的是,这仅仅移除了软件包,可能不会删除所有的配置文件和数据文件。
- **图形界面工具:** 在图形用户界面(GUI)操作系统中,如Windows,卸载程序通常可以通过“控制面板”或“设置”中的“程序和功能”部分完成。
- **自动化卸载脚本:** 对于更复杂的系统,可能需要编写自动化脚
0
0
相关推荐







